The Levy Company is currently hiring an experienced Journeyman Electrician/Electrical Foreman. Under general supervision, Electricians install and repair wiring, electrical fixtures, power equipment, and components of machinery and equipment following electrical code, manuals, specifications, schematics, and blueprints. This position will also be responsible for other construction and commercial duties as assigned.

Essential Functions may include but are not limited to:
  1. Read and interpret mechanical, architectural, and electrical drawings and code specifications to determine wiring layouts.
  2. Troubleshoot, test, and repair various equipment and electrical systems.
  3. Perform repairs, upgrades, and preventive maintenance to equipment and electrical systems.
  4. Plan and coordinate work, determine equipment needs, and develop sequences of steps to ensure work completion.
  5. Supervise and train apprentices and helpers.
Required Qualifications:
  1. A minimum of four years of electrical experience.
  2. Journeyman electrician license issued by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ation.
  3. Valid Texas driver license.
  4. High school diploma or equivalent.
  5. Must provide own hand tools.
  6. TWIC card.
Preferred Qualifications:
  1. Valid Texas commercial driver license.
Required Competencies:
  1. Advanced understanding of mechanical and electrical systems.
  2. Basic mathematical skills.
  3. Ability to organize own work and that of apprentices and helpers.
  4. Ability to follow oral and written instructions.
  5. Ability to communicate effectively.
  6. Ability to work under minimal supervision.


Working Environment:

Work is performed in primarily outdoor environments with constant exposure to noise, dust, fumes, noxious odors, gases, mechanical and electrical hazards, moving objects, sharp edges, and temperature extremes.

Physical Demands:
  • Frequent operation of equipment with vibrating and moving parts.
  • Frequent and repeated hand and arm movement to manipulate tools, handles, and levers.
  • Frequent and repeated lifting from ground to various heights up to 50 pounds individually, and team lifting heavier items.
  • Frequent and repeated exerting of force up to 100 pounds.
  • Standing and walking for extended periods of time.
  • Occasional walking on uneven and / or unpaved terrain.
  • Frequent climbing steps, ladders, and in/out/onto vehicles.
  • Frequent and repeated bending, stooping, crawling, kneeling, reaching, and crouching.
  • Visual acuity to drive motor vehicles and mobile equipment, distinguish colors, and to read printed and electronic documents.
  • Hearing capacity to receive, perceive, and react to common driving and construction environment noises.
